Meet Author Col Joseph Alexander For Book Signing and Dinner, 6 June

The Marine Corps Association will host a meet the author and book signing event with Col Joseph Alexander, author of Utmost Savagery, The Three Days of Tarawa and Through the Wheat: The U.S. Marines in World War I.

Additionally, the Marine Corps Heritage Foundation will commemorate the 90th anniversary of the historic WWI Battle of Belleau Wood with a dinner and presentation by notable Marine Corps historian and author Col. Joseph Alexander on June 6 at 5:30p.m. Alexander will lead a discussion on one of the most notable U.S. Marine Corps battles in which a massive German offensive smashed through French lines threatening Paris in May of 1918. U.S. Marines stopped the German assault after five days of fighting, establishing the highly regarded fighting reputation of the Marines.
